Minor-major 7th inversions create a unique tension between the minor third (♭3) and major seventh (7). Characteristic color of the melodic minor mode.

Theory

The mMaj7 chord combines minor third and major seventh. Its inversions create sophisticated tensions used in modern jazz and film music.
